COVID Conscious Fixtures – 2021 Home Design Trend

The COVID pandemic has produced a year of challenges, but with these challenges has come great ingenuity in many fields, including that of interior design!  One large problem that the pandemic has posed is that of reducing the number of germs we transfer on a daily basis.  We rarely think of fixtures such as faucets, knobs, handles and light switches because they can become such peripheral aspects of our home, but these items can be host to more germs than we know.

One ingenious new design invention is that of the touchless light switch.  Lights can be controlled with the wave of a hand.  This especially comes in handy (no pun intended) in bathrooms and kitchens which we often associate as the main hubs of germ spread.

If touchless light switches aren’t your thing, then maybe consider a home lighting system that can be controlled remotely from your phone, or better yet… your voice!  Amazon’s Alexa has the capability to turn on and off lights, lock doors, play music, control the temperature and much more with the sound of your voice through the Brilliant Smart Home System.  This system also allows you to control your smart home with your phone.  Today, there are so many smart home systems available, this is just one option.

Another great design feat which has become common in many homes, and will probably grow in popularity due to the pandemic, is the touchless faucet.  With healthcare providers putting such an emphasis on washing our hands, touchless faucets are a great way to limit the spread of germs.  Not only are touchless faucets practical, but they are also sleek and modern.

Cabinet handles and pulls are design aspects that many people put a lot of thought into when choosing, but you might want to consider more than just aesthetics when picking out your cabinetry accessories.  Consider ease of cleaning when deciding on cabinet fixtures.  Handles that are attractive, but difficult to clean between might not be the best choice for your home.  Think about how often you use your cabinets throughout the day.  If you’re a passionate home chef, or if you have a lot of traffic in and out of your kitchen, then investing in cabinet accessories that are easy to sanitize might be the smartest choice for you.  Many companies are jumping on this idea due to the pandemic and are combining style with convenience, so more and more easy-to-clean options will become available in the future.  If you’re a big fan of modernism, bypass the handles and pulls altogether and opt for touch-open cabinets!

Investing in these COVID conscious fixtures is not only beneficial for you and your family, but can also be an added bonus when considering the resale of your home.  I think that COVID conscious fixtures will become the new standard in home building and buying!
